黑狐家游戏

从其他服务器SQL获取数据的详细方法与步骤解析,怎么从 其他服务器sql获取数据

欧气 1 0

在当今的数据驱动时代,企业需要高效地从多个来源收集、整合和分析数据以做出明智的商业决策,跨服务器获取SQL数据库中的数据是一项常见且重要的任务,本文将详细介绍如何安全有效地从其他服务器上的SQL数据库中获取数据。

理解跨服务器数据访问的需求和挑战

需求分析:

从其他服务器SQL获取数据的详细方法与步骤解析,怎么从 其他服务器sql获取数据

图片来源于网络,如有侵权联系删除

  • 业务需求: 企业可能需要在不同部门或分支之间共享关键信息,例如客户数据、销售报告等。
  • 技术需求: 需要确保数据传输的安全性和完整性,同时保持系统的性能和稳定性。

挑战识别:

  • 安全性: 数据传输过程中可能会面临网络攻击和数据泄露的风险。
  • 兼容性: 不同服务器之间的数据库版本和结构可能存在差异。
  • 性能: 大量数据的实时同步可能会导致系统负载过高。

选择合适的跨服务器数据同步工具和技术

工具选择:

  • 数据库复制服务: 如Oracle GoldenGate、Microsoft SQL Server Replication等,这些工具可以实现在线数据复制,但通常成本较高。
  • ETL(Extract, Transform, Load)工具: 如Informatica、Talend等,适用于复杂的数据转换和加载过程。
  • 云服务解决方案: 如AWS Database Migration Service、Google Cloud SQL等,提供了简便的数据迁移和管理功能。

技术选择:

  • SSH隧道加密: 通过SSH建立安全的隧道来保护数据传输。
  • SSL/TLS加密: 在数据传输过程中使用SSL/TLS协议进行加密。
  • API接口调用: 使用RESTful API或其他Web服务接口来远程访问数据。

实施跨服务器SQL数据获取的策略

策略制定:

  • 明确数据访问权限: 根据不同角色的需求分配相应的访问权限。
  • 设置数据备份计划: 定期备份数据以防数据丢失或损坏。
  • 监控数据流量: 监控数据传输过程中的流量和使用情况。

实施步骤:

  1. 准备环境: 安装必要的软件包和服务,如SSH客户端、数据库客户端等。
  2. 配置防火墙规则: 允许必要的服务端口通过防火墙。
  3. 建立连接: 使用SSH命令行工具或图形界面程序建立到目标服务器的连接。
  4. 执行查询: 发送SQL查询语句到目标数据库服务器。
  5. 处理结果: 接收并处理返回的数据集,将其存储在本地数据库或文件系统中。

注意事项:

从其他服务器SQL获取数据的详细方法与步骤解析,怎么从 其他服务器sql获取数据

图片来源于网络,如有侵权联系删除

  • 测试环境验证: 在实际部署之前,先在测试环境中验证整个流程的有效性和安全性。
  • 文档记录: 详细记录每一步的操作过程和相关参数设置,以便于后续维护和故障排除。

持续优化和维护跨服务器SQL数据获取系统

定期审查:

  • 安全审计: 定期对系统进行全面的安全审计,检查是否存在潜在的安全漏洞。
  • 性能调优: 根据实际情况调整数据库配置和网络带宽,以提高数据传输效率和响应速度。

更新升级:

  • 软件更新: 及时安装最新的补丁和安全更新,防止已知的漏洞被利用。
  • 硬件升级: 如果发现现有硬件无法满足需求,可以考虑更换更高性能的服务器。

培训教育:

  • 员工培训: 对相关人员进行数据安全和操作技能方面的培训,提高整体团队的专业素养。

从其他服务器上获取SQL数据是一项涉及多方面因素的任务,需要综合考虑业务需求、技术能力和风险管理等因素,通过合理的选择工具和技术、制定详细的实施策略以及持续的优化和维护工作,可以有效实现跨服务器SQL数据的可靠获取和应用。

标签: #怎么从 其他服务器sql获取数据

黑狐家游戏
  • 评论列表

留言评论